Abstract:

A laminar jet issuing from a three-dimensional orifice of elliptical shape is analyzed by the use of the boundary layer assumptions in the mixing region of the jet. The full three-dimensional equations are reduced to a set of quasi-two-dimensional boundary layer equations. These equations are solved numerically and predict a decrease in the half width dimension of the major axis of the ellipse. This decrease has been observed in the case of three-dimensional turbulent jets but has not been predicted by any previous analysis. Author
